Product Overview
DAC8043AFSZ-REEL7 is an improved high-accuracy 12bit multiplying digital-to-analogue converter. Featuring serial input, double buffering, and excellent analogue performance, it is ideal for applications where PC board space is at a premium. Improved linearity and gain error performance permit reduced parts count through the elimination of trimming components. Separate input clock and load DAC control lines allow full user control of data loading and analogue output. The circuit consists of a 12bit serial-in/parallel-out shift register, a 12bit DAC register, a 12bit CMOS DAC, and control logic. Serial data is clocked into the input register on the rising edge of the CLOCK pulse. When the new data word has been clocked in, it is loaded into the DAC register with the LD input pin. It is used in applications such as ideal for PLC applications in industrial control, programmable amplifiers and attenuators, digitally controlled calibration and filters, and motion control systems.
- True 12-bit accuracy, fast 3-wire serial input, power supply range from 4.5V to 5.5V
- Pin-for-pin upgrade for DAC8043, standard and rotated pinout
- Relative accuracy is ±1.0LSB maximum at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- Differential nonlinearity is ±1.0LSB maximum at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- Gain error is ±2.0LSB maximum at (TA = 25°C, data = FFFH)
- Output current settling time is 1µs maximum at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- DAC glitch is 20nVs maximum at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- Output noise density is 17nV/√Hz maximum at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- Multiplying bandwidth is 2.4MHz typical at (VDD = 5V, VREF = 10V, -40°C <lt/> TA <lt/> +85°C)
- Operating temperature range from -40°C to +85°C, 8-lead SOIC-N package
